Chapter 1

The little princess of the elite circles had just returned to the country, only to be diagnosed with a terminal STD—her body covered in festering sores, with less than two weeks to live.

When the news reached my wedding, my stepbrother burst into tears and threatened to kill himself, demanding that I switch places with him as the groom.

I brushed off my suit, unmoved.

"Back when the little princess drew lots to choose her husband and picked me, you were the one who begged Dad to swap our names and steal the marriage arrangement."

"Now that she's dying and your shot at becoming the heir is gone, you're having regrets? I'm already getting married. If you think I'm going to take your place and jump into that fire pit, keep dreaming!"

To my disbelief, my fiancée Julia Henson rushed over and wrapped her arms around him, shooting me a look of disapproval.

"The ceremony hasn't started yet, and we haven't signed the marriage certificate—it doesn't count!"

"I can't just stand by and watch Neil suffer. Today's groom has to be him. You're his older brother—sacrificing for your younger brother is only right!"

My eyes flew wide open. I couldn't believe what I was hearing.

My father and stepmother nodded eagerly, tossing identity documents at my feet.

"I've already changed your name back," my father said. "The little princess is insatiable—never uses protection in bed. She's declared that before she dies, she's going to have one last fling as a bride."

"Neil was raised with the best of everything. He absolutely cannot catch some filthy disease, and he certainly can't become a widower. The other family isn't one to cross—if we back out, they won't let you go. Your only choice is to marry in!"

The two people in this world who should have been closest to me were now shoving me into the fire without a moment's hesitation.

My heart turned to ash. I closed my eyes briefly, then let out a cold laugh.

"Fine. Have it your way."

...

After I handed over the groom's suit to my stepbrother Neil Simmons, he bounced over to Julia and threw his arms around her, his face flushed.

"Jules, do I look handsome?"

Julia's eyes sparkled with undisguised admiration. She answered softly, "Very handsome."

"When I was designing it, I subconsciously used these measurements. I never expected it to fit you so perfectly. I guess it was fate—you were always meant to be my husband."

I froze for a moment, then couldn't help but smile bitterly.

No wonder the suit had felt too tight around the waist when I tried it on.

Because Julia had designed it herself, I hadn't wanted to disappoint her, so I'd kept quiet about it.

I'd thought I'd just put on a few pounds lately. Turns out the man she'd always wanted to marry was someone else entirely.

Seeing that I wasn't going to cause trouble, my stepmother actually stopped rolling her eyes at me for once.

My father even went so far as to praise me, saying I was finally acting like a proper older brother.

Watching the four of them laugh and chat like one happy family, I spoke up, my voice dripping with sarcasm.

"You don't actually think that just because I agreed to marry into the family in Neil's place, I'd do it without a bride price, do you?"

Their expressions stiffened.

"What do you want?"

"Ten percent of Simmons Corp shares."

The moment the words left my mouth, my father's face darkened.

"You ungrateful bastard! Those shares are for your brother! And here I was just thinking you'd finally learned some sense—turns out you're back to stealing from him already. Who do you think you are?!"

I'd always known my father played favorites. But even so, the words still cut deep.

"Ha! That company was built by my mother before she died. If Neil—the son of a homewrecker—can get shares, why the hell can't I?!"

"Don't forget—I'm your son too!"

My father's face turned a furious shade of purple. If he hadn't been worried about delaying the ceremony, he probably would have slapped me across the face right then and there.

He forced down his rage.

"Your mother was my wife when she was alive—even she belonged to the Simmons family, let alone her company. I decide who gets shares!"

"I fed you, clothed you, raised you to this age—you should be grateful!"

He'd been saying this ever since the day he brought Neil and his mother into our home.

Back then, I didn't understand. Why was it that a father raising his own child—the most natural thing in the world—somehow became something I had to grovel and give thanks for?
